Job Summary We are seeking an experienced ECAD Librarian to manage and maintain our schematic symbol and PCB footprint libraries, ensuring our design teams work from accurate, consistent, and manufacturable component data. Key Responsibilities Develop, maintain, and organize the ECAD library of Allegro schematic symbols and PCB footprints, ensuring alignment with design team requirements and project specificationsCreate and validate complex schematic symbols and PCB footprints in Allegro, ensuring compliance with IPC standards and company guidelinesBuild and maintain complete component metadata, including part numbering, attributes, and datasheet linkageCollaborate with the manufacturing team to adjust symbols and footprints as needed, ensuring compliance with design for manufacturability (DFM) requirements and alignment with JEDEC standards and industry guidelinesPartner with electrical engineers and layout designers to resolve library issues quickly and prevent errors from propagating into fabrication and assemblyEstablish and enforce best practices for library version control, part approvals, and data integrityCollaborate with component suppliers to obtain accurate technical data and ensure compatibility with design requirementsPerform detailed quality checks on symbols and footprints to guarantee design accuracy and reliability You May Be a Good Fit If You Have Bachelor's degree in Electrical Engineering or a related field, or equivalent professional experience5+ years of experience in ECAD library management, including creating Allegro schematic symbols and PCB footprintsExpertise in Allegro PCB Editor and related tools for symbol and footprint creationGood understanding of Part Life Cycle, EOL parts, and RoHS/EU complianceStrong understanding of IPC standards for PCB footprint creation, JEDEC package standards, and package dimensional tolerancesExperience working directly with manufacturing teams to adapt designs for optimal manufacturability and yieldExperience with version control systems for ECAD libraries, such as Git or PLM softwareExcellent attention to detail and ability to manage complex libraries with a focus on accuracy and efficiencyStrong communication and collaboration skills, with the ability to work cross-functionally with electrical and manufacturing teamsExperience with scripting languages (e.g., SKILL for Allegro) to automate library management tasksKnowledge of BOM management and integration with ECAD libraries Benefits Medical, dental, and vision packages with generous premium coverage$500 per month credit for waiving medical benefitsHousing subsidy of $2k per month for those living within walking distance of the officeRelocation support for those moving to San Jose (Santana Row)Various wellness benefits covering fitness, mental health, and moreDaily lunch and dinner in our officeUnlimited compute budget subject to ROI justification How We’re Different Etched believes in the Bitter Lesson.
